Dual Fuel Engine
The Dual Fuel engine is a kind of engine that uses a mixture of gas fuel or diesel fuel or can run off of diesel by its self. The dual fuel engine is not capable of running on gas alone. These engines do not have ignition systems and do not use spark plugs.
Because diesel is not a pure gas, and it is not a pure diesel designed engine, it has some disadvantages in the department of fuel efficiency, as well as Methane slippage.. Like for instance, the fuel efficiency could be 5% to 8% less than in a comparable lean-burn, spark-ignited engine at 100 percent load. It can even be lower or higher loads.
Lift Truck Fuel Sources and Classifications
There are certain recycling materials handling applications that could prove really challenging for lift trucks. For instance, scrap metal is one of these problems. In order to successfully handle things like this needs utilizing the correct type of equipment for the job.
In this write-up, the 7 major lift truck classes are discussed, including the power sources like liquid propane gas, hydrogen fuel cell, gasoline, diesel and electric. The power source is linked to several of these particular classes. The main power sources for forklifts comprise Diesel, Gasoline, Battery, Fuel Cell and Propane.
The most common overall are electric powered trucks, mostly in Class III, II and class I forklifts. In Classes IV and V, internal combustion trucks are more common. The most common electric power source is the lead-acid battery. Among internal combustion trucks, roughly more than 90 percent are propane powered.
The battery is the forklifts most popular power source. Battery powered units make up around 60% of the new forklifts sold in the USA. Their benefits comprise: quiet operation, less maintenance requirements, the ability to be used inside and outside with no harmful emissions.
